OpenTSA patch installation

This patch kit was developed and tested on the following operating systems: SuSE Linux 7.2, OpenBSD 3.0. It should also compile and run on Win32 systems. If you try to use it on other platforms please let me know your problems or success. Steps of installation:

  2. Download the correct version of OpenSSL from http://www.openssl.org/. The version number of OpenSSL required is included in the file name of the patch.

  3. Extract OpenSSL:

    	$ gzip -cd openssl-VERSION.tar.gz | tar xf -
    
  4. Apply the OpenTSA patch (you should not see any error messages while applying the patch):

    	$ cd openssl-VERSION
    	$ gzip -cd ts-VERSION.patch.gz | patch -p1
    
  5. Follow the instructions in the OpenSSL documentation for configuring and building OpenSSL. Here is a brief summary:

    	$ ./config
    	$ make
    	$ make test
    	$ make install # you may have to log in as root to do this!
    
  6. Read the ts(1) and tsget(1)manuals:

    	$ man ts
    	$ man tsget
